What's the story with the black box? Why do people have them?
My daughter had one when she passed her test, fitted by the insurers it monitors the driving. It reduced her first policy from £900 to £650. When she renewed it went down to £550, on the other hand her friends went up 30 %. All depends how much you trust your childrens driving whether they are worthwhile, and whether they remember they are being monitored, for her it was a great idea..
